2008 Audi A5 and Audi S5

2008_audi_s5.jpg
Audi will unveil the new 2008 Audi A5 at the Geneva Auto Show next month. The car is larger than the TT coupe and will slot in between the A4 and A6. The car will have the option of a 3.0L V6 or a 3.2L V6. There will aslo be an S5 and RS5. The A5 convertible will also eventually replace the A4 convertible. The car will also feature the company's quattro awd system.

The 2010 VW Phaeton will Make it to the U.S. Despite Poor Sales

VW's Phaeton was not a success for VW in the U.S. The company planned on only selling 20,000 of them, but they only managed to sell a quarter of that amount when they pulled the car in 2005. Even with though the car barely managed to register on the sales screen, the company is moving forward with the next version of the car.

Audi is Planning on Milking the A5 Line with a New Convertible and Sportback

Audi is not content with their current line up. They are set to double their model count by 2015. “We have 22 vehicles in the lineup already and the other 18 in our heads,” said Michael Dick, Audi’s Product Development Chief. Audi already has the new Q5 SUV, the A7 four-door coupe and the A1 compact car in the works. In addition the company is planning on making more variants of the upcoming A5 coupe.

Audi Unveils an A4 that Rivals the Fuel Economy of the Toyota Yaris

Audi has unveiled their new Audi A4 1.9 TDI e. The car features a 115 horsepower engine and is capable of using only 5.3L of diesel fuel per 100km, which translates to 44mpg, when the car is equipped with the six-speed manual.
